Test of a universality ansatz for the contact values of the radial distribution functions of hard-sphere mixtures near a hard wall

Abstract

Recent Monte Carlo simulation results for the contact values of polydisperse hard-sphere mixtures at a hard planar wall are considered in the light of a universality assumption made in approximate theoretical approaches. It is found that the data appear to fulfill the universality ansatz reasonably well, thus opening up the possibility of inferring the properties of complicated systems from the study of simpler ones.
